Product Details

Verified Reactivity
Mouse, Human
Antibody Type
Monoclonal
Host Species
Rat
Immunogen
LPS activated DBA/J mouse B cells
Formulation
Phosphate-buffered solution, pH 7.2, containing 0.09% sodium azide.
Preparation
The antibody was purified by affinity chromatography and conjugated with FITC under optimal conditions.
Storage & Handling
The antibody solution should be stored undiluted between 2°C and 8°C, and protected from prolonged exposure to light. Do not freeze.
Application

FC - Quality tested

Recommended Usage

Each lot of this antibody is quality control tested by immunofluorescent staining with flow cytometric analysis. For flow cytometric staining, the suggested use of this reagent is ≤1.0 ?g per million cells in 100 ?l volume. It is recommended that the reagent be titrated for optimal performance for each application.

Excitation Laser
Blue Laser (488 nm)
Application Notes

The GL7 antibody does not block the binding of CD22 with sulfated a2-6-sialyl-LacNAc.

Cross-reactivity to ferret has been reported by a collaborator, but not verified in house.

Antigen Details

Structure
35 kD
Distribution

Germinal center B cells, activated B and T cells

Function
Upregulated on activated B cells via in situ repression of CMP-Neu5Ac-hydroxylase
Ligand/Receptor
Neu5Ac-recognizing lectins
Cell Type
B cells, T cells
Biology Area
Immunology, Innate Immunity
Molecular Family
CD Molecules
